With Christmas parties on the horizon and autumn brides walking down the aisle, A Legendary Event is pleased to announce the opening of their full-service Atlanta special events venue 3109 Piedmont Estate and Gardens, opening early fall 2012. This venue can host up to 400 guests in their cocktail reception area, and 175 guests in their ballroom. A Legendary Event's Atlanta caterers and award-winning design staff round out the venue to make any celebration memorable.

About A Legendary Event:

Formed in 1997, A Legendary Event has grown into a multi-million dollar full-service event enterprise. CEO and Founder Tony Conway is admired by top CEOs, celebrities, politicians and world-class galas for his attention to detail and penchant for providing fresh, trend-setting and uniquely presented fare, always with the client in mind.
